Maintenance 

 

 

DANGER

 

 

 

 

Damage from vacuum generator that has not been switched off 

 

Personal injury 

►  Switch off vacuum generators (such as blowers or pumps) during cleaning, 

maintenance and repair work. 

 

 

Component 

Task 

Maintenance period 

Filter cartridge 

Clean and check for damage 

According to the operating 
instructions of the connected devices 

Replace 

At least once after 5 cleanings or at 
least once every 2 years 

Connection hoses 

Check for damage and leaks 

Monthly or after repairs have been 
conducted 

Plastic housing and bracket  Check for damage and tears 

Check when performing filter 
maintenance 

4.1  Removing and cleaning filter cartridges 

 

 

WARNING 

 

 

 

Whirling dust particles 

 

Damage to eyes and respiratory tract 

►  Wear eye protection 

 

 

►  Wear respiratory protection 

 

 

 

 

 
1.  Open the filter housing.  
2.  Remove the filter cartridge (6) from the housing. 
3.  Replace heavily contaminated or damaged filter cartridge. 
4.  Blow the filter cartridges from the inside out (never wash or brush it). 

Filter cartridges must be blown from the inside out using dry 
compressed air (max. 5 bar) until there are no more dust formations. 

5.  Before installation, check the clean filter cartridge for damage to the  

paper bellows and the rubber gaskets. 
Damaged filter cartridges must not be reused.  
If you are not sure, install a new filter cartridge. 

6.  Insert the filter cartridge (6). 
7.  Make sure that the filter cartridge is grounded (see chapter 3.2.1). 
8.  Close the housing cover.  

 

 

To blow out the unit, set a pipe on a compressed-air gun that is bent at the end by 
approx. 90°. The pipe must be long enough to reach the bottom of the cartridge.
